Clinton’s campaign chair John Podesta emails Cheryl Mills, who is one of Clinton’s lawyers at the time, as well as being her former chief of staff. He writes, “On another matter….and not to sound like Lanny, but we are going to have to dump all those emails so better to do so sooner than later.”

Mills replies with a joke, “Think you just got your new nick name :).” (WikiLeaks, 11/1/2016)

This is in reference to the New York Times front-page story from earlier in the day, publicly revealing that Clinton exclusively used a private email account while secretary of state.

“Lanny” is a likely reference to Lanny Davis, who was a special counsel to President Bill Clinton, and is a longtime media surrogate for Bill and Hillary Clinton. Less than a week later, Davis will publicly advocate that Clinton should be transparent with her emails.

By saying “dump,” Podesta could mean dump them to the public, or he could mean get rid of them. Unfortunately, there are no more comments from him or Mills to help clarify his meaning.

These emails will be released by WikiLeaks in November 2016.
